About the role

The Pharmacy Technician is responsible for compounding IV medications, managing automated dispensing machines, and maintaining inventory levels. They also support pharmacists by preparing orders and ensuring accurate recordkeeping within the hospital environment.

Summary

  • ***Pharmacy Technician Trainee - On job training through Pharmacy Technician University courses **
  • The Pharmacy Technician is an entry-level position. Following a training period, the Technician should be able to competently use hospital EMR for daily duties, use automated dispensing machines, compound IVs, charge and credit, fill orders, answer phones and doors, and stock the department.

Responsibilities

  • (20%)
  • Runs reports, pulls medications and restocks Automated Dispensing Machines, follows up on narcotic discrepancies, trouble-shoots problems, aides and trains nurses on dispensing problems. (20%)
  • Compounds IV and piggyback medications, using aseptic technique and universal precautions. Follows USP 797 guidelines. (20%)
  • Support the work of the pharmacists, assists in the set-up of orders and aide in the expedition of orders to the nursing units. (20%)
  • Replaces and fills floor stock: fills EMS boxes and crash cart trays and delivers to appropriate area; completes monthly floor stock on other hospital departments; stocks UD area and IV room.. (10%)
  • Fills, reconciles and exchanges 24 hour UD medicine carts. (10%)
  • Answers phone, retrieves tubes and faxes. OTHER D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ES: Repackages non-unit dose medications correctly using re-packager. Compounds oral and topical solutions and ointments. Run labels using the computer in an accurate and timely manner. Helps with duties as directed by the pharmacist on duty. Assists with inventory and recordkeeping. Able to add barcodes to products, including compounded items, IVPB’s, etc. Performs other related miscellaneous duties

Equivalent Experience

New hire and transfers before October 1, 2015 must possess a full technician license or limited pharmacy license through the state of Michigan. Effective October 1, 2015, all incumbents, new hires and transfers to this position must possess a pharmacy technician temporary, limited or full license through the state of Michigan Individuals with a temporary license must obtain a full license through the state of Michigan within 365 days of obtaining the temporary license. A Pharmacist Intern License with the State of MI is also acceptable.
